Gettin' Together is a 1960 jazz album by saxophonist Art Pepper playing with Conte Candoli, Wynton Kelly, Paul Chambers, and Jimmy Cobb.

The sleeve notes (by Martin Williams) describe the album as 'a sort of sequel to the earlier Art Pepper Meets the Rhythm Section', which also featured the Miles Davis rhythm section of its time.

Track listing

  1. "Whims of Chambers" (Paul Chambers) – 6:56
  2. "Bijou the Poodle" (Art Pepper) – 5:48
  3. "Why Are We Afraid" (Dory Langdon; André Previn) – 3:36
  4. "Softly, as in a Morning Sunrise" (Sigmund Romberg; Oscar Hammerstein II) – 6:55
  5. "Rhythm-a-Ning" (Thelonious Monk) – 7:15
  6. "Diane" (Art Pepper) – 5:03
  7. "Gettin' Together" (Art Pepper) – 7 :50
(Recorded on 29 February 1960.)
